.container.page{padding-top:2.5rem;padding-bottom:4rem}.eyebrow.svelte-171l7w4{margin:0 0 .55rem;font-family:var(--font-body);font-size:var(--type-meta);text-transform:uppercase;letter-spacing:.18em;color:var(--color-accent);font-weight:600}h1.svelte-171l7w4{font-family:var(--font-display);font-variation-settings:"opsz" 48;font-weight:600;font-size:var(--type-h1);line-height:1.08;letter-spacing:-.02em;margin:0 0 1.1rem;color:var(--color-ink);text-wrap:balance}h1.svelte-171l7w4 em:where(.svelte-171l7w4){font-style:italic;color:var(--color-accent);font-variation-settings:"opsz" 48}.lead.svelte-171l7w4{color:var(--color-ink-soft);font-size:var(--type-lead);line-height:1.6;margin:0 0 2rem;max-width:56ch}.tool-list.svelte-171l7w4{list-style:none;margin:0;padding:0;border-top:1px solid var(--color-rule)}.tool-row.svelte-171l7w4{border-bottom:1px solid var(--color-rule);transition:opacity .2s ease}.tool-list.svelte-171l7w4:has(.tool-row:where(.svelte-171l7w4):hover) .tool-row:where(.svelte-171l7w4):not(:hover){opacity:.55}.tool-link.svelte-171l7w4{display:grid;grid-template-columns:minmax(0,1fr) auto;align-items:end;column-gap:1.5rem;padding:1.6rem 0;text-decoration:none;color:inherit}.tool-link.svelte-171l7w4:focus-visible{outline:2px solid var(--color-accent);outline-offset:4px;border-radius:var(--radius-chip)}.tool-body.svelte-171l7w4{min-width:0}.tool-name.svelte-171l7w4{font-family:var(--font-display);font-variation-settings:"opsz" 36;font-weight:600;font-size:1.6rem;line-height:1.15;letter-spacing:-.02em;margin:0 0 .35rem;color:var(--color-ink);text-wrap:balance}.tool-link.svelte-171l7w4:hover .tool-name:where(.svelte-171l7w4),.tool-link.svelte-171l7w4:focus-visible .tool-name:where(.svelte-171l7w4){color:var(--color-accent)}.tool-tagline.svelte-171l7w4{font-family:var(--font-display);font-variation-settings:"opsz" 18;font-style:italic;color:var(--color-accent);margin:0 0 .5rem;font-size:1.05rem;line-height:1.4}.tool-blurb.svelte-171l7w4{margin:0;color:var(--color-ink-soft);font-size:.98rem;line-height:1.55;max-width:56ch}.tool-cta.svelte-171l7w4{font-family:var(--font-body);font-size:var(--type-meta);text-transform:uppercase;letter-spacing:.18em;color:var(--color-accent);font-weight:600;white-space:nowrap;opacity:0;transform:translate(-.25rem);transition:opacity .2s ease,transform .2s ease}.tool-link.svelte-171l7w4:hover .tool-cta:where(.svelte-171l7w4),.tool-link.svelte-171l7w4:focus-visible .tool-cta:where(.svelte-171l7w4){opacity:1;transform:translate(0)}@media (max-width: 600px){h1.svelte-171l7w4{font-size:clamp(1.7rem,6vw + .4rem,2.2rem)}.tool-link.svelte-171l7w4{padding:1.3rem 0;column-gap:.75rem}.tool-name.svelte-171l7w4{font-size:1.4rem}.tool-link.svelte-171l7w4{grid-template-columns:minmax(0,1fr)}.tool-cta.svelte-171l7w4{opacity:1;transform:none;margin-top:.6rem}}
